Safety features
Microwave ovens heat and cook food using electromagnetic radiation in the microwave spectrum of radio spectrum. This radiation induces polar molecules in the food to vibrate and produce thermal energy. This process is referred to as dielectric heating. Contrary to conventional ovens ovens can also defrost food without preheating. It is essential to follow the directions on how to make use of your microwave.
When you are choosing a new microwave oven, make sure you choose one that has a child safety feature to stop children from accidentally activating the appliance or opening it while it is operating. This will lower the chance of burns or injuries. Certain models have interlocking switches that prevent the production of microwave radiation until the door is shut. Some also have cool-touch doors and control panels that reduce the risk of burns.
Certain consumers are concerned about radiation exposure when using microwaves. However the FDA says that microwaves do not pose a health risk as long as the user isn't in the oven at the time it's running. However, the agency has received reports of microwaves that continue to generate radiation even when the door is open. In this case, consumers should stop using microwaves immediately.
In addition to the child lock function, some models also include a padlock button that prevents accidental operation of the oven by locking the buttons on the control panel. This feature is particularly useful in households with small children. This feature is great to prevent children from accidentally activating a microwave and causing a fire, or other issues.

Cooking methods
Microwave ovens are able to be fitted with a range of cooking modes to suit the requirements of your kitchen. These range from basic microwave cooking to convection baking and grilling. These options are more flexible than traditional ovens and are ideal for defrosting and heating. These cooking methods can also improve the quality of food.
Depending on the model you select, the microwave could come with a glass turntable, a shorter metal rack or high metal rack. You can use these accessories to cook a variety of food items like brownies and cakes. Many of these appliances come with an interior that is non-stick and resists staining and splatters, which makes them easier to clean. Some models come with a removable cover that helps to prevent spills from happening.
A combination microwave/oven is a different option. These units provide the benefits of both a microwave and grill built in (http://www.fluencycheck.Com) and an oven in one unit, which is ideal for kitchens with a limited space. They also allow you to grill your food and then brown it by using the oven's powerful airflow, resulting in delicious meals. They can also be used to bake or roast.
Certain models can be set in a flush position to give your cabinet a seamless appearance. When installed at a comfortable height they can be used in conjunction with wall-mounted ovens to help you move dishes. You can find models with stainless steel built in microwave oven-in trim kits that will ensure that they are seamlessly integrated into your decor.
The microwaves are available in a variety of sizes and forms, so it is important to choose the right one for your home. It's crucial to decide whether you'll be using it for simple reheating, or more complex meals. If you intend to use it for baking then you'll need select a larger model.
Consider a convection microwave for those who plan to do lots of roasting and baking. These appliances combine the speed of a microwave and the power and precision of an oven, which can save you a significant amount of time.
